Simi Valley, California – A tragic small plane crash claimed the lives of a pilot and his son on Saturday afternoon. The victims have been identified as 69-year-old Paul Berkovitz from Westlake Village and his 36-year-old son, Matthew J. Berkovitz from Thousand Oaks. The incident occurred just after 2 p.m. local time on the 200 block of High Meadow Street in the Wood Ranch area.

The aircraft involved in the crash was a Vans RV-10, a single-engine fixed-wing plane that had taken off from William J. Fox Airfield in Lancaster and was headed toward Camarillo Airport. Paul Berkovitz was the sole occupant of the plane, which crashed shortly after departure, leaving both victims deceased at the scene from multiple blunt force injuries. Authorities have classified their deaths as accidental.

The crash also caused significant damage to two nearby homes, which caught fire upon impact. Thankfully, residents were inside at the time but were evacuated safely without any injuries. However, the incident has left two families displaced; one home has been designated as unsafe for habitation (red-tagged), while another has sustained moderate damage (yellow-tagged).

Approximately 40 firefighters from the Simi Valley Fire Department responded swiftly to the scene, working alongside the Simi Valley Police Department in extinguishing the flames and managing the wreckage. Smoke was visibly rising from the homes immediately after the crash, complicating rescue efforts. The fire crews successfully contained the fire, and salvage operations followed.

A National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B) investigator has been dispatched to the site to begin an investigation into the crash. The NTSB plans to document the wreckage and transfer it to a secure facility for comprehensive evaluation. The entire investigative process, which will involve collaboration with the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A), could take up to 18 months to determine the cause of the crash. A preliminary report from the FAA is expected within the next 30 days.

Witnesses reported that the plane circled the area multiple times before the crash, with some suggesting that it appeared to be flying erratically. The RV-10 model, which has been involved in previous accidents, is part of a larger category of amateur-built aircraft that raises safety concerns among aviation experts. There are about 30,000 amateur-built planes certified in the United States, with the RV-10 being one of the more popular choices among aviation enthusiasts.

In light of the tragic event, the Berkovitz family has expressed gratitude towards first responders while requesting privacy during this difficult time. Paul Berkovitz was remembered as an aviation enthusiast with a passion for animal rescue. He was particularly known for his involvement with the nonprofit organization Pilot N Paws, which flies shelter dogs to new homes, underscoring his deep commitment to animal welfare.

As investigators continue their work, the aviation community is paying close attention to the happenings surrounding this particular incident, prompting discussions about design and safety standards concerning experimental aircraft. Future regulatory considerations may emerge as a result of this unfortunate occurrence.
